In the world of Monster Hunter games, ‘weapon hitstops’ is a term used to describe an impactful visual feedback system. When a player executes a powerful attack, such as a Great Sword’s True Charged Slash, the animation of the attack will briefly slow down after landing a hit. This serves two purposes: it helps players recognize when they’ve struck a monster’s vulnerable area, and it adds a sense of satisfaction by showcasing the potency of their chosen weapon.
